Trainman Posted January 5, 2007 Share Posted January 5, 2007 Now that I look at it, does that skid behind the front one (don't know them by name) mount to the front subframe crossmember? The front skid mounts under the rad at the front, then under the cross member for the motor/suspension. The next one also bolts onto the motor cross member and then to a special bar BP supplies for the rear attachment. They can be used independently of each other but if the motor cross member is dropped, it would put the holes out of alignment and a new or modified rear bar would be needed I think, plus the bends would have to be re-done a bit. As for the front skid, maybe elongating the mounting holes might work if there is enough material.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
